Internet Fitness in store
Find your fit. Paromita Pain Playgroundonline ( http://www.playgroundonline.com/index.aspx) is for sports buffs who have no time to run to the store to pick up sporting equipment and accessories. Besides offering the advantage of one being able to order equipment without leaving a chair, the site is a gallery of sports and athletic stuff you can view simply to learn about the latest in the world of fitness. From footwear, books, DVDs, health and fitness equipment and accessories, food supplements and more, the site is a comprehensive online store for the fitness conscious. Wide variety
The home page loads easily even on the slowest connection. Navigation is a pleasure thanks to the orderly headers provided on the side of the page. The site has a wide of range of products that merit browsing. The categories are well defined, making it easier to zero in on what you want. You can shop by category, price or brand. This is the rare sports portal that has a pedometer at a reasonable price. Enough information is provided about the product of choice to enable buyers to make an informed decision. But a word of caution: do read up more about the product of choice before you type in your credit card details. Don’t be afraid that your card details get into wrong hands because the site is a McAfee (Hackersafe) certified one, scanned everyday and the certificate renewed and posted. Registration is mandatory but don’t let the process get to you. With your first registration you get 15 per cent off and there are special discounts for schools and corporates. Products, the site promises, will be shipped across in seven days. The fanshop is an interesting concept. It sells t-shirts and memorabilia of the Chennai super series at reasonable prices. As with buying anything online, return policies are important. Playgroundonline is reasonable enough on returns though customers are encouraged to talk to customer service personnel. Not just sporting equipment, the site has books and videos too. In short a complete virtual sporting world! Know other sites that have sporting equipment worth a check out?
